Theory of pasteurisation. Notices that microorganisms were causing the alcohol to go sour. Germ theory.
Louis Pasteur
1 of 20
Studied Pasteur's theories and discovered that you could grow microorganisms successfully on agar jelly. He discovered the microorganisms in Anthrax (sheep) and then later discovered the microorganisms causing tuberculosis and cholera
Robert Koch
2 of 20
Noticed that the milkmaids were not catching small pox because they had got cow pox from the cows. Invented the vaccination where he would inject people with cow pox which prevented them getting small pox which was much worse.
Edward Jenner
3 of 20

1854 he mapped all the cholera deaths and was able to trace the outbreak to one pump. He removed the handle of the pump so that it couldn't be used and the outbreak died down. Proved cholera came from water- little impact no germ theory
John Snow
7 of 20
Unimpressed in the way nurses were trained She sent a report to the government Nightingales school of nursing Uniform Clean bedding Worked in the Crimean war professionalises nursing
Florence Nightingale
8 of 20
Circulation of blood Heart acted like a pump. Arteries carried blood away from the heart. Veins carried blood towards the heart. Valves prevented black flow.
William Harvey
9 of 20
Proved Galen wrong Jaw was one bone Fabrik of the human body Human anatomy
Versalius
10 of 20
Magic bullet 1 1909 Salvarsan 606 Combined dye with various chemicals to target only disease causing microbes 606th compound tested and worked- Dr Hata First time chemical drugs had been used to cure illness
Paul Ehrlich

Wrote a report on what could be done to benefit peoples lives. The report recommended: Everyone in work would pay national insurance out of their wages to fund benefits such as sick pay and pensions Creation of the NHS
Beveridge report

Drew up a plan to build new sewers in London. Not accepted at first but after the Great Stink the government funded Bazalgette and the sewers were built. Pump sewage away from London into the sea.
Bazalgette
